Rare island lady Posted February 5, 2023 #119 Share Posted February 5, 2023 2 hours ago, mafig said: Wait....we are only Diamond, but have a suite booked. Am I correct in assuming that when we are in the CK (this is Serenade) they won't be using our Diamond vouchers but will use our suite vouchers.🤔 There is no CK on Serenade. You will be using the CL (being in a full suite, not a JS), or your choice of the DL (due to you being Diamond). In the CL...you can do suite's free drinks, but only during official happy hour in there. Just be sure to tell them not to charge your vouchers for those. In the DL (drinks only served during happy hour), or in any bar around the ship (at any time) you have a limit of four per person, per day.... at 14.00 and under for no charge. 1 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

cruisegirl1 Posted February 6, 2023 #121 Share Posted February 6, 2023 2 minutes ago, villager70 said: yes every morning except last on Harmony. Mariner and Independence do last morning also Thanks, one of my favorite perks. We have found that all the ships without a coastal kitchen provide breakfast the last day in specialty restaurants for Pinnacle/suites, since that would be the place for the suites to have breakfast. On ships with no CK, there is either a combined suite/pinnacle daily breakfast or two restaurants are used. Guess it depends on suite/pinnacle numbers. We’ve had it both ways, and either is fine with us. m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
